Too high starts to cause other troubles. I think that the real time people want 10uS scheduling, but even the ipipe and rt-preempt has 18us-70uS delays at times IIRC. So 5e4 to 1e5 is about the extreme end of the road for CONFIG_JIFFIES_HZ . I think even long term that 1e5 to 1e6 would be extreme because of speed of light issues, etc. Hpet is only 1.4e7 IIRC. I think that you should start with: 1) CONFIG_FIXED_PIT_HZ=50 CONFIG_JIFFIES_HZ=2000 2) try it out and fix any bugs, send the fixes to Linus to see if how much he bitches. 3) if you still need CONFIG_JIFFIES_HZ to be larger, double it and then goto 2. 4) enjoy your higher frequency jiffies I bet that even that going to somewhere between 2e3 through 1e5 will make you want to change a few things for performance and sanity reasons. So I'd focus on that before I even thought about 1e6 through 1e10 . Plus I think the interest level really fails off to go that extreme. Just making JIFFIES_HZ != PIT_HZ will require patches. Yes tsc or hpet or whatever users might benefit in several ways. 1) both tsc and hpet might be able to bump up to a more accurate value on entry to idle and then test to see if anything got scheduled. 2) hpet can set set one shot timers for the next up coming event on idle if it's sooner than when the PIT interrupt is suppose to come in. Of course update the jiffies when that hpet interrupt comes. >Users of those kernel are willing > to pay the cost of the overhead to have better resolution Yes realtime users with something like hpet might not vary the pit timer, but place hooks to update the jiffies between pit interrupts like idle, scheduler(task switch), etc. And use the hpet one shot interrupts as well. > - avoid direct usage of the jiffies variable, instead use jiffies() > (inline or MACRO), IMO monotonic_clock() would be a better name I don't know I think it could remain a variable you usual just want it to be a light-weight memory read not a call out to an hpet and then a math conversion, or a call out to tsc that then has to known about if the tsc represents work or time, and if the cpu has been slowed for power save reasons etc etc etc. I think you want a symbol exported gpl of something like void force_update_jiffies(void); that you can call in different hook locations to force the update of jiffies from non-interupt sources. Actually you might want more than one version of that function or have it take an argument, becuase some people might want to be super lazy and only update it when the enter or leave idle, while others(real timers) might want it updated on every interupt and scheduling decision point. Hook placement might have strong affinity with where the preemption hooks are placed for the various levels of preemption(voluntary,standard,rt). But If I understand Linus's points he wants jiffies to remain a memory fetch, and make sure it doesn't turn into a singing dancing christmas tree.
